Flavor Development

The combination of hearty chicken thighs and sweet potatoes creates a delightful balance of flavors. The b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s contribute richness and moisture during roasting. If you prefer, you can use boneless, skinless thighs for a leaner option, but keep in mind that they might cook faster and require careful monitoring to avoid dryness. The garlic and rosemary not only enhance the chicken but also infuse the sweet potatoes with an aromatic profile, making every bite satisfying.

When incorporating olive oil into the chicken marinade, aim for a light coating that allows for better browning. If you find that the chicken isn't browning to your liking, you might consider broiling it for a couple of minutes at the end of the roasting period. This small adjustment can create those crispy, golden edges that contrast beautifully with the tender meat and sweet potato mash.

Perfectly Roasted Sweet Potatoes

Sweet potatoes add a natural sweetness that complements the savory chicken. Make sure to cut them into uniform pieces to ensure even cooking. Dicing them into 1-inch cubes works well, as this size typically cooks in about 30 minutes alongside the chicken. If you're short on time, you can microwave the sweet potatoes for a few minutes to kickstart the cooking process before adding them to the baking sheet.

If you're looking to elevate the flavor further, consider adding a sprinkle of cinnamon or a drizzle of honey on the sweet potatoes before roasting. This will create a caramelized exterior and enhance their sweetness, creating a delightful contrast with the savory chicken. Remember to keep an eye on them, as caramelization can lead to undesirable burning if left unattended.

Ingredients

Gather the following ingredients:

Ingredients

  • 4 b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s
  • 2 large sweet pot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 3 tablespoons olive oil
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h rosemary, chopped
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ional: lemon wedges for serving

Make sure all ingredients are fresh for the best flavor.

Instructions

Follow these steps to create your Sheet Pan Chicken with Sweet Potatoes:

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).

Prepare the Chicken

In a large bowl, mix olive oil, minced garlic, rosemary, salt, and pepper. Add the chicken thighs and coat them evenly with the mixture.

Prepare the Sweet Potatoes

In another bowl, toss the diced sweet potatoes with olive oil, salt, and pepper until coated.

Arrange on Baking Sheet

Place the chicken thighs on one side of a parchment-lined baking sheet and the seasoned sweet potatoes on the other side.

Roast in the Oven

Roast everything in the preheated oven for about 30 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C) and the sweet potatoes are tender.

Serve

Let the dish cool for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y with lemon wedges if desired.

Pro Tips

  • For added flavor, marinate the chicken in the seasoning mix for a few hours before cooking. Also, feel free to substitute the chicken thighs with breasts if you prefer, but adjust the cooking time accordingly.

Make-Ahead and Storage

This Sheet Pan Chicken with Sweet Potatoes is a great candidate for meal prep. You can easily marinate the chicken thighs the night before and let them sit in the refrigerator to absorb the flavors until you're ready to roast. Additionally, the diced sweet potatoes can be prepped ahead of time; just store them in an airtight container to prevent browning.

Once cooked, le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to four days. They reheat well in the microwave or can be baked in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through. This dish also freezes beautifully. Simply package the cooled meal in a freezer-safe container, and it can be stored for up to three months.

Serving Suggestions

Serving this dish with lemon wedges adds a fresh brightness that elevates the flavors. A squeeze of lemon juice just before eating brightens the savory notes and offers a refreshing contrast to the sweet potatoes. For a more filling meal, consider pairing it with a side salad or steamed green beans to balance the plate with some greens.

If you want to vary the vegetables, feel free to swap out the sweet potatoes for butternut squash or carrots. Both options roast well and carry their own distinct flavors. Just remember to adjust cooking times slightly based on the vegetable chosen, as some may require more or less time to become tender.

Questions About Recipes

→ Can I use other vegetables?

Absolutely! Broccoli, bell peppers, or carrots are great options. Just ensure they have similar cook times to sweet potatoes.

→ How can I store leftovers?

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ave before serving.

→ Is it possible to make this dish ahead of time?

You can prep the chicken and sweet potatoes in advance and store them in the fridge. When ready to cook, just pop everything on the baking sheet.

→ Can I double the recipe?

Yes, just ensure to use a larger baking sheet or two separate sheets to allow for even roasting.
